JS> I'm not sure why you would want to encrypt a hash of a string, a hash
JS> (sha1) is already non reversible and you also do not need to
JS> base64_encode a sha1 hash (try <?php print sha1('hello'); ?>)..
JS> If you want to do RSA public key encryption you will need to use an
JS> external application such as gpg or pgp.
JS> Also please note if you are intending to encode the plain text three
JS> different ways you are exposing yourself with base64, base64 is not an
JS> encryption technique.
JS> The way I understand your question is data -> sha1 -> rsa ->
JS> base64_encode but it could also be
data ->> sha1
data ->> rsa
data ->> base64
JS> The latter is not secure because you are using base64 which is not even
JS> trivial to decode.
